In my handle(int event) routine, ENTER, LEAVE, PUSH, DRAG, RELEASE, work fine, but not MOVE. In r5555 MOVE works fine, and that version is what I continue to use. In r5940 and r5941 it is broken. Hope you can restore it in a later release

| Back to it. I tried the revised handle with r5941 - still does not work, as expected. I forgot to mention one fact though - the MOVE does work with r5941 but only in a narrow band along the right and bottom edges of the drawing.
I also did as I said I would, compiled r5555 in debug, broke on my MOVE handler, and discovered the source was in Widget.cxx. Comparing the code with the r5941 version revealed two changes since r5555. Restoring four lines of code from the r5555 version makes everything work fine - (for me anyway, I assume those changes were for a reason. Here are the changes starting at Line 740 of the r5941 Widget.cxx:
if(ret){ //added // Set belowmouse only if handle() did not set it to some child: if (!contains(fltk::belowmouse())) fltk::belowmouse(this); } //added break;
case LEAVE: case DND_LEAVE: clear_flag(HIGHLIGHT); ret = handle(event); break;
case DND_ENTER: case DND_DRAG: if (!takesevents()) break; set_flag(HIGHLIGHT); // figure out correct type of event: event = (contains(fltk::belowmouse())) ? DND_DRAG : DND_ENTER; // see if it wants the event: ret = handle(event); if(ret){ //added // Set belowmouse only if handle() did not set it to some child: if (!contains(fltk::belowmouse())) fltk::belowmouse(this); } //added

| One possible cause is that fltk2 has a bug in the move routine with widgets at the same level. If you have:
Group Widget1 Widget2 Widget3 --- move handle here
Widget3 is currently incorrectly getting the fltk::event_x() and fltk::event_y() offset by the position and space used by the previous widgets (widget1 and 2 in the example). Try printing the values of fltk::event_x()/y() in your move routine. | |
